Transaction 4f2dffaeef6023a79a6deff685841ba5dc73f9c2233e0d81c75cfaaba118e962
2 Input
2 Outputs
- 4f2dffaeef6023a79a6deff685841ba5dc73f9c2233e0d81c75cfaaba118e962:0
- 4f2dffaeef6023a79a6deff685841ba5dc73f9c2233e0d81c75cfaaba118e962:1
value 2682100
address 1H8oWftzdvhgYQU211vzyDi8EYL35mDX5o
value 40075140
address 1FxSiZT4cKG2tAEy9VSGT6SbPaDDQAwzKQ